    England Under-17s take penalty prize and reduce Holland to tears

    England 1-1 Holland (England win 4-1 on penalties)

    Solanke 25, Schuurman 39

    The penalty shootout was handled expertly by one team, nervously by the other, and, when it was all over, England had won the final and it was Holland in tears. An omen for Brazil? That might be pushing it too far but, for all the talk of B Leagues and a crisis for homegrown talent, England proved worthy champions of Europe for the second time in four years.


    Evertons young right-back Jonjoe Kenny converted the decisive spot-kick after a hard-fought final finished 1-1 and, with no extra-time, went straight to the lottery that has failed England so many times at so many levels. Not at the TaQali National Stadium in Malta.
